The ideal candidate will bring deep expertise in small molecule drug discovery, with a demonstrated track record of leading medicinal chemistry programs from hit identification to preclinical candidate selection.
Experience with emerging therapeutic modalities, including targeted protein degradation (PROTACs), oligonucleotides, peptides, or other beyond‑rule‑of‑5 modalities is highly desirable.
This role requires strong scientific leadership, strategic thinking, excellent communication skills, and the ability to thrive in a dynamic, matrixed research environment.
Key Responsibilities
Lead medicinal chemistry efforts across one or more discovery programs from concept through candidate selection.
Drive the design, synthesis, and multiparameter optimization of novel compounds, effectively integrating computational insights and data‑driven SAR/SPRs to optimize potency, selectivity, ADME/PK, and safety profiles.
Serve as a scientific leader within multidisciplinary project teams, partnering closely with biology, DMPK, pharmacology, toxicology, translational sciences, and computational chemistry colleagues to define project strategies and Target Product Profiles.
Apply innovative approaches and new technologies to accelerate drug discovery. Embrace advanced chemistry technologies, including automation‑enabled workflows, generative AI, and digital design tools as well as new advanced modalities such as chemical induced proximity.
Manage and oversee external CRO chemistry activities to ensure timely, rigorous execution and alignment with project objectives.
Contribute to scientific assessments of external innovation opportunities, including therapeutic assets, platform technologies, and collaborative partnerships.
Communicate recommendations and scientific updates clearly to senior leadership, while mentoring junior scientists to foster a collaborative, high‑performing research culture.
Contribute to fostering a collaborative, innovative, and high‑performing research culture.
Qualifications & Skills
Education
Ph.D. in Medicinal Chemistry, Organic Chemistry, or a related scientific discipline, with a strong record of scientific achievement through publications, patents, and/or delivered drug discovery programs.
Experience
8–10+ years of pharmaceutical or biotechnology industry experience with a proven track record of advancing programs from hit/lead optimization through to preclinical candidate selection.
Demonstrated success leading medicinal chemistry programs from hit identification and lead optimization through preclinical candidate selection.
Strong experience working effectively within multidisciplinary drug discovery teams.
Therapeutic expertise in neuroscience, immunology, rare diseases, or related fields is desirable.
Experience with targeted protein degradation (e.g., PROTACs/molecular glues), oligonucleotides, peptides, macrocycles, or other emerging modalities is considered a strong advantage.
Prior experience in managing external collaborations and chemistry CRO activities is preferred.
Technical & Leadership Skills
Deep understanding of medicinal chemistry, synthetic organic chemistry, and modern drug discovery principles.
Strong knowledge of ADME/PK, early safety assessment, develop ability, and translational considerations in drug discovery.
Familiarity with computational chemistry insights, structure‑based drug design, and data‑driven discovery tools and digital workflows to guide design cycles.
Strong problem‑solving and critical‑thinking skills, with the ability to navigate scientific complexity and ambiguity.
Excellent communication and influencing skills, with demonstrated ability to lead and articulate scientific concepts and strategic recommendations to multidisciplinary teams and to senior leadership.
High degree of scientific curiosity, innovation mindset, and commitment to delivering impactful medicines to patients.
